1st Grade Number and Operations Worksheets

These number and operations grade 1 worksheets help students master fundamental math concepts that form the foundation for all future mathematical learning. What does first grade math look like in practice? Students work with numbers up to 120, develop counting strategies, and explore the relationship between addition and subtraction. Teachers often notice that first graders struggle most with transitioning from concrete manipulatives to abstract number symbols, particularly when working with teen numbers where the written form doesn't match the spoken pattern. What concepts are covered in number and operations grade 1 curricula?

Number and operations grade 1 standards focus on counting, place value understanding, and basic addition and subtraction within 20. Students learn to count to 120, understand place value for two-digit numbers, and develop fluency with addition and subtraction facts within 10. The Common Core emphasizes understanding numbers as groups of tens and ones, which builds the foundation for later multi-digit arithmetic.

Teachers frequently observe that students master rote counting but struggle with number recognition in random order. Many first graders can count to 100 but become confused when asked to identify 67 or 84 out of sequence. This disconnect between counting ability and number sense requires targeted practice with number identification activities.

How do first grade number skills connect to later math learning?

The number concepts first graders learn directly support second grade work with three-digit numbers and multi-step problems. Students who develop strong place value understanding in first grade show greater success with regrouping in addition and subtraction algorithms later. The relationship between addition and subtraction that students explore in grade 1 becomes the foundation for fact family work and problem-solving strategies.

Classroom teachers notice that students who struggle with teen number concepts (understanding that 17 means 1 ten and 7 ones) often carry these difficulties into second grade place value work. Early intervention with place value activities and consistent use of base-ten blocks helps prevent these gaps from widening.

Why do students find addition within 20 challenging?

Addition within 20 requires students to bridge across 10, which represents a significant cognitive leap from simple counting strategies. When solving 8 + 5, students must decompose numbers and use the make-ten strategy rather than counting on fingers. This transition from concrete counting to abstract number relationships challenges many first graders who rely heavily on visual and tactile support.

Speed math addition worksheets can help build fluency, but teachers observe that rushing students through facts without conceptual understanding often backfires. Students who memorize without understanding struggle when numbers get larger or when they encounter subtraction problems. Building number sense through manipulatives and visual models supports both accuracy and speed development.

How can teachers effectively use these worksheets in their classrooms?

These worksheets work best when integrated with hands-on activities and mathematical discussions rather than assigned as isolated practice. Teachers find success using them as warm-up activities, homework reinforcement, or assessment tools after concept introduction with manipulatives. The variety of problem types allows teachers to differentiate instruction by selecting specific skills that match individual student needs.

Many educators use the answer keys to create self-checking stations where students can verify their work independently. This approach builds confidence and allows teachers to focus on students who need additional support. The visual format appeals to first graders who are still developing reading skills, making math practice accessible even for emerging readers.
